AX-S
managing
director
David
Shand
said
the
breakthrough
contract,
which
has
been
under
negotiation
for
the
past
three
months,
could
be
signed
”by
the
end
of
next
week
with
a
major
subsea
operator”.
This
would
be
a
major
milestone
for
the
AX-S
project,
targeting
70%
savings
on
deepwater
subsea
well
intervention
programmes,
which
to
date
has
generated
widespread
interest
but
no
firm
contracts.
”Like
with
all
new
technology,
the
clients
are
lining
up
to
be
the
second
customer,”
Shand
told
a
press
conference
at
Offshore
Europe
in
Aberdeen.
